What is a design operations manager?

Design Operations Managers are professionals who streamline and optimize processes within design teams to improve efficiency, collaboration, and the quality of creative output. They bridge the gap between design, product, and business operations by implementing workflows, managing resources, and ensuring projects stay on track. Their responsibilities often include project management, budget oversight, and facilitating communication across teams. By establishing best practices and removing operational barriers, Design Operations Managers enable designers to focus more on creative work and innovation.

How does a design operations man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to improve workflow efficiency?

A Design Operations Manager works closely with design, product, engineering, and marketing teams to streamline processes, set clear priorities, and remove obstacles that hinder productivity. They often facilitate regular check-ins, build and optimize workflows, and implement tools or systems that foster communication and transparency. By acting as a liaison and ensuring alignment between departments, they help the broader team deliver high-quality design work on time, while also identifying opportunities to refine processes for future projects.

What is the difference between Design Operations Manager vs UX Designer?

AspectDesign Operations ManagerUX Designer
Primary FocusOversees design processes, tools, and team workflowsDesigns user experiences and interfaces
Required SkillsProject management, process optimization, leadershipUser research, wireframing, prototyping
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with design teams, product managers, and developersWorks directly on user interface and experience design
Common CertificationsProject Management Professional (PMP), Agile certificationsUX certifications (e.g., NN/g, Human Factors)

The Design Operations Manager focuses on streamlining design workflows and managing teams, while the UX Designer concentrates on creating engaging user experiences. Both roles often collaborate but serve different functions within the design process.

Position Summary


As Operations Manager, you will serve as a key leader driving the successful execution of projects while safeguarding financial performance, managing risk, and strengthening client relationships from concept to completion. You will partner closely with the General Superintendent to guide and support the estimation and field teams, promoting accountability, collaboration, and high performance. Reporting directly to the President, you will set strategic project goals and ensure consistent delivery excellence and client satisfaction. You will also champion business development efforts by building and nurturing long-term relationships with clients, consultants, and industry organizations.


This is a unique opportunity to join the senior leadership team of a growing mass timber contractor, where you will help shape the company’s direction, influence its culture, and contribute directly to its continued success while helping to build the future of the organization.


As an Operations Manager your key accountabilities will involve:


  • Overseeing overall company operations, establishing performance standards and KPIs, and driving continuous improvement across project teams.
  • Establishing and continuously improving company-wide operational systems, project controls, financial reporting, and procedures, including the Operations Manual.
  • Overseeing project financial controls, forecasting, invoicing, and reporting while identifying opportunities to improve profitability and support business growth.
  • Partnering with the President on strategic planning, business development, marketing initiatives, client relationships, and strengthening the company’s position within the mass timber industry.
  • Leading contract reviews, client negotiations, change management, and risk mitigation to protect the company’s interests and support successful project outcomes.
  • Conducting regular site visits and working with field leadership to monitor quality, project execution, operational consistency, and adherence to company standards.
  • Providing regular operational and financial reporting to the President and representing the company at client meetings, industry events, committees, and professional forums.
  • Leading, coaching, and developing Project Managers, Coordinators, and Administrators through performance management, career planning, succession planning, and professional development.
  • Collaborating with the General Superintendent, HR, and executive leadership on workforce planning, recruitment, staffing, performance management, and employee development.
  • Championing a positive, inclusive, safety-focused, and high-performance culture built on professionalism, accountability, and continuous learning.


As an Operations Manager your success is dependent on:


  • The willingness to learn and change in a dynamic and fast paced, deadline driven environment that is continually growing and adapting.
  • Employing a creative approach to effectively serve clients and trade contractors.•    The ability to write and define processes and procedures in collaboration with the Operations team.
  • A commitment to working collaboratively and supporting team efforts.
  • The ability to remain calm and supportive with new teams as they learn and develop, fostering a constructive learning environment.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ills for effective collaboration with both internal and external clients.
  • The ability to excel in a demanding and stimulating work environment.
  • The ability to prioritize tasks effectively to meet deadlines.
  • A strong focus on accuracy, results, and attention to detail.

As an Operations Manager your experience and qualifications will include: 


  • 10+ years of construction management experience, ideally with a general contractor, or a larger subcontractor, or supplier.
  • Demonstrated experience in mass timber construction, fabrication, or a closely related construction environment.
  • Previous experience managing and developing Project Managers and project teams.
  • Post-secondary industry education in construction is an asset.
  • Comprehensive computer and technical skills such as Microsoft Office applications, Project Management software, accounting software etc.
  • Ability to complete financial reporting, weekly progress reports, monthly cost and profit reporting.
  • Experience working on and independently leading multiple projects with $1-25+ million-dollar budgets.
  • Executive-level written and verbal communication skills and leadership abilities.
